Why Timely EMI Payments Are Important
Paying your EMIs on time offers multiple benefits:
- Protects Credit Score: Late or missed payments negatively affect your credit history, making future borrowing difficult.
- Avoids Extra Charges: Banks often charge late fees or penalties for delayed EMIs, increasing your debt burden.
- Reduces Financial Stress: Regular payments help you stay on top of your finances and plan your budget effectively.
Timely EMI payments are not just about compliance—they’re a step toward financial freedom.
Understanding Your EMI Payment Schedule
Each loan comes with a structured EMI schedule specifying due dates, interest, and principal breakdown. Knowing this schedule is the first step toward smooth management.
- EMI Amount: Understand your monthly installment to plan your budget accordingly.
- Due Dates: Keep track of your payment deadlines to avoid penalties.
- Interest vs Principal: Knowing how much goes toward interest and principal helps in making smart prepayment decisions.

Practical Tips to Manage EMI Payments
Managing EMI payment doesn’t have to be complicated. Here are actionable tips to stay organized and stress-free:
1. Automate Your Payments
Setting up auto-debit ensures you never miss a due date. Automation saves time, prevents late fees, and helps build consistent repayment habits.
2. Prioritize High-Interest Loans
If you have multiple EMIs, focus on loans with higher interest first. Paying off these loans reduces overall interest and helps you achieve debt freedom faster.
3. Create a Monthly Budget
Allocate a fixed portion of your income specifically for EMI payments. Budgeting ensures you have sufficient funds available each month and avoids overspending.
4. Make Prepayments When Possible
Prepaying part of your principal reduces your interest burden and shortens the loan tenure. Even small prepayments contribute to long-term savings.
5. Track Your Progress Regularly

Common EMI Payment Mistakes to Avoid
Even careful borrowers can make errors that impact EMI payments. Avoid these common mistakes:
- Missing Payments: Late payments attract penalties and hurt your credit score.
- Ignoring Loan Terms: Not understanding your loan terms may lead to unexpected charges.
- Overcommitting: Taking EMIs beyond your repayment capacity causes financial stress and limits flexibility.
Awareness of these mistakes ensures a smooth repayment experience and financial stability.
